Background
Selectin E (SELE), also known as E-selectin, is a cell adhesion molecule that plays a pivotal role in the immune system and inflammation by mediating the interaction between leukocytes (white blood cells) and endothelial cells during the inflammatory response. SELE is expressed primarily on activated endothelial cells and is rapidly upregulated in response to inflammatory cytokines, such as tumor necrosis factor-alpha (TNF-α) and interleukin-1 (IL-1). This adhesion molecule is essential for leukocyte rolling, the first step in the process of leukocyte extravasation, which allows immune cells to exit the bloodstream and migrate to sites of inflammation or tissue injury.
E-selectin is part of the selectin family, which includes two other members: P-selectin (platelet and endothelial cell adhesion molecule) and L-selectin (leukocyte adhesion molecule). These molecules share structural and functional similarities but differ in their expression patterns and roles in the inflammatory process. E-selectin plays a specific role in acute and chronic inflammatory responses, such as those seen in autoimmune diseases, infections, and cardiovascular diseases like atherosclerosis.
Protein Structure
The SELE gene is located on chromosome 1q22-q25 and encodes a protein of 610 amino acids with a molecular weight of approximately 65-75 kDa. E-selectin is a single-pass transmembrane glycoprotein that consists of several distinct domains:
Extracellular Domain:
- The extracellular region of E-selectin is highly glycosylated and comprises several key structural motifs:
- N-terminal C-type lectin domain: This domain is crucial for the recognition and binding of specific carbohydrates on the surface of leukocytes, particularly sialyl Lewis X (sLeX), a glycan structure present on leukocyte surface proteins.
- Epidermal growth factor (EGF)-like domain: Located adjacent to the lectin domain, this region provides structural stability and supports interactions with other proteins or ligands.
- Complement regulatory repeats (CR): SELE contains six short consensus repeat domains, also known as sushi domains, which contribute to its flexibility and the proper spatial orientation required for leukocyte interaction.
Transmembrane Domain:
- The transmembrane region is a hydrophobic stretch of about 23 amino acids, which anchors E-selectin to the endothelial cell membrane. This domain maintains the structural integrity of the molecule within the cell membrane and ensures correct surface presentation.
Cytoplasmic Tail:
- The intracellular or cytoplasmic tail is relatively short and consists of approximately 35 amino acids. This region is involved in the transmission of intracellular signals that regulate E-selectin's surface expression and recycling. It may also play a role in intracellular trafficking and in facilitating interactions with the cytoskeleton.
Post-Translational Modifications:
- E-selectin is subject to several post-translational modifications, including N-linked glycosylation, which is critical for its stability and ligand-binding ability. Glycosylation also influences the folding, maturation, and surface expression of the molecule. Phosphorylation of the cytoplasmic domain may also occur, regulating its interactions with intracellular signaling molecules and potentially controlling its recycling or degradation.
Classification and Subtypes
E-selectin is part of the selectin family, which is classified into three main members based on their structure and function:
E-selectin (SELE):
- Primarily expressed on endothelial cells and plays a key role in inflammatory responses.
P-selectin:
- Expressed on platelets and endothelial cells, involved in hemostasis and inflammatory processes by mediating interactions with leukocytes and platelets.
L-selectin:
- Expressed on leukocytes and is essential for lymphocyte homing and leukocyte-endothelial interactions in secondary lymphoid organs.
E-selectin has no known isoforms or subtypes. However, its expression can be induced by various inflammatory stimuli, and its activity can be modulated by interaction with other cell surface molecules, including P-selectin glycoprotein ligand-1 (PSGL-1) and CD44 on leukocytes.
Function and Biological Significance
The primary function of E-selectin is to mediate leukocyte rolling on the endothelium during the early stages of the inflammatory response. This process is essential for the recruitment of immune cells, particularly neutrophils, monocytes, and T cells, to sites of infection, injury, or inflammation. The interaction between E-selectin and its ligands on leukocytes is characterized by transient and reversible binding, allowing leukocytes to "roll" along the endothelial surface before firmly adhering and migrating into the surrounding tissue (a process known as extravasation).
- Leukocyte Rolling:
- E-selectin binds to glycoprotein ligands, such as PSGL-1 and sLeX, on the surface of leukocytes. This interaction is calcium-dependent and facilitates the initial tethering and rolling of leukocytes on the endothelial surface under the influence of blood flow. The rolling process slows down the leukocytes and enables them to encounter other adhesion molecules, such as ICAM-1 and VCAM-1, which mediate firm adhesion and subsequent transmigration.
- Inflammatory Response:
- E-selectin expression is induced in response to pro-inflammatory cytokines, such as TNF-α, IL-1, and lipopolysaccharide (LPS). Once expressed on the endothelial surface, E-selectin initiates leukocyte recruitment, which is essential for the immune system's ability to target and eliminate pathogens or damaged cells. E-selectin-mediated rolling is the first step in a multi-step process that culminates in leukocyte migration into the affected tissue, where they carry out immune surveillance, pathogen clearance, and tissue repair.
- Angiogenesis:
- E-selectin is involved in the regulation of angiogenesis, the formation of new blood vessels from pre-existing vasculature. E-selectin expressed on endothelial cells can influence the migration and adhesion of endothelial progenitor cells, contributing to the formation of new vessels in response to tissue hypoxia or during tumor progression.
- Tumor Metastasis:
- E-selectin plays a role in cancer progression by facilitating the adhesion and migration of circulating tumor cells (CTCs) to distant organs, promoting tumor metastasis. The interaction between E-selectin on endothelial cells and selectin ligands on CTCs is crucial for the metastatic process, allowing cancer cells to exit the bloodstream and colonize secondary sites.
Clinical Issues
Inflammatory Diseases:
- Dysregulation of E-selectin is implicated in a variety of inflammatory disorders, such as rheumatoid arthritis, inflammatory bowel disease (IBD), and psoriasis. Elevated levels of E-selectin have been detected in patients with these conditions, reflecting the ongoing recruitment of leukocytes to inflamed tissues.
Atherosclerosis:
- E-selectin plays a critical role in the development of atherosclerosis, a chronic inflammatory disease of the arteries. The recruitment of leukocytes to the endothelial lining of blood vessels, mediated by E-selectin, contributes to the formation of atherosclerotic plaques. Increased expression of E-selectin has been linked to endothelial dysfunction and vascular inflammation in atherosclerosis.
Sepsis:
- During sepsis, a systemic inflammatory response to infection, E-selectin is highly expressed on endothelial cells throughout the body. This can lead to the widespread recruitment of leukocytes, contributing to the vascular damage and organ failure observed in severe cases of sepsis.
Cancer:
- E-selectin is involved in cancer metastasis, particularly in cancers that metastasize to the liver, lungs, and bone marrow. Inhibition of E-selectin-mediated interactions between tumor cells and endothelial cells is being explored as a potential therapeutic strategy to prevent metastasis.
Summary
SELE, encoding E-selectin, is a crucial cell adhesion molecule that mediates the interaction between endothelial cells and leukocytes during inflammation and immune responses. Structurally, E-selectin consists of an extracellular domain with a C-type lectin domain, EGF-like domain, and complement regulatory repeats, along with a transmembrane domain and a short cytoplasmic tail. E-selectin is upregulated in response to inflammatory signals and is essential for the recruitment of immune cells to inflamed or injured tissues, a process that is critical for pathogen clearance, tissue repair, and the resolution of inflammation. However, dysregulation of E-selectin is implicated in various pathological conditions, including autoimmune diseases, atherosclerosis, sepsis, and cancer metastasis. As such, E-selectin is a potential therapeutic target for modulating inflammation and preventing tumor progression.
